Family Fun in August 2023: Los Angeles Itinerary

Saturday, August 26: Exploring Santa Monica

Start your family adventure by immersing yourself in the vibrant atmosphere of Santa Monica Pier. In the morning, take a leisurely stroll along the iconic pier, enjoying the ocean breeze and stunning views. Let the kids enjoy the numerous arcade games and amusement park rides. In the afternoon, visit Pacific Park, the amusement park located on the pier, and ride the Ferris wheel for panoramic vistas of the coastline. As the evening sets in, explore the bustling Third Street Promenade, known for its shopping, dining, and street performers. Grab a delicious family dinner at one of the many restaurants in the area.

  • Santa Monica Pier: Enjoy the attractions and arcade games. Estimated cost: $10-$30 per person. Time spent: 2-3 hours.
  • Pacific Park: Ride the Ferris wheel and other thrilling rides. Estimated cost: $20-$40 per person. Time spent: 2-3 hours.
  • Third Street Promenade: Shop, dine, and enjoy street performances. Estimated cost: Varies. Time spent: 2-3 hours.
Sunday, August 27: Exploring Griffith Park

Start the day by visiting the iconic Griffith Observatory located in Griffith Park. Explore the exhibits and enjoy the breathtaking views of the city and the stars. Take a hike through the park's trails and have a family picnic surrounded by nature. In the afternoon, head to the Los Angeles Zoo, located within Griffith Park, and get up close with a variety of animals. End your day with a visit to Travel Town Museum, where kids can explore vintage trains and learn about the history of rail travel.

  • Griffith Observatory: Explore exhibits and enjoy city views. Estimated cost: Free admission, planetarium shows require tickets. Time spent: 2-3 hours.
  • Griffith Park: Hike, have a picnic, and enjoy nature.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 2-4 hours.
  • Los Angeles Zoo: Discover a wide range of animals. Estimated cost: $20-$30 per person. Time spent: 3-4 hours.
  • Travel Town Museum: Learn about vintage trains. Estimated cost: Free admission, train rides require tickets. Time spent: 1-2 hours.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ique family experience, consider visiting Kidspace Children's Museum in Pasadena. This interactive museum offers hands-on exhibits, outdoor play areas, and educational programs that engage kids of all ages. Another local favorite is the Zimmer Children's Museum located in Los Angeles. It focuses on cultural diversity, community responsibility, and creativity through interactive exhibits. Both museums provide a fun and educational experience for the whole family.

Additionally, if your family enjoys outdoor activities, consider a visit to the South Coast Botanic Garden in Palos Verdes. This hidden gem offers stunning gardens, walking trails, and a children's garden where kids can explore and learn about nature. The garden also hosts various events and workshops throughout the year.
